Change Log
----------
**0.4** (2016-11-21)
- DSMR v2.2 serial settings now uses parity serial.EVEN by default (`pull request #5 <https://github.com/ndokter/dsmr_parser/pull/5>`_)
- improved asyncio reader and improve it's error handling (`pull request #8 <https://github.com/ndokter/dsmr_parser/pull/8>`_)
**0.3** (2016-11-12)
- asyncio reader for non-blocking reads. (`pull request #3 <https://github.com/ndokter/dsmr_parser/pull/3>`_)
**0.2** (2016-11-08)
- support for DMSR version 2.2 (`pull request #2 <https://github.com/ndokter/dsmr_parser/pull/2>`_)
**0.1** (2016-08-22)
- initial version with a serial reader and support for DSMR version 4.x

Known issues
------------
If the serial settings SERIAL_SETTINGS_V2_2 or SERIAL_SETTINGS_V4 don't work.
Make sure to try and replace the parity settings to EVEN or NONE.
It's possible that alternative settings will be added in the future if these
settings don't work for the majority of meters.

"""Asyncio protocol implementation for handling telegrams."""
import asyncio
import logging
from functools import partial
from serial_asyncio import create_serial_connection
from . import telegram_specifications
from .exceptions import ParseError
from .parsers import TelegramParser, TelegramParserV2_2
from .serial import (SERIAL_SETTINGS_V2_2, SERIAL_SETTINGS_V4,
is_end_of_telegram, is_start_of_telegram)
def create_dsmr_reader(port, dsmr_version, telegram_callback, loop=None):
"""Creates a DSMR asyncio protocol coroutine."""
if dsmr_version == '2.2':
specifications = telegram_specifications.V2_2
telegram_parser = TelegramParserV2_2
serial_settings = SERIAL_SETTINGS_V2_2
elif dsmr_version == '4':
specifications = telegram_specifications.V4
telegram_parser = TelegramParser
serial_settings = SERIAL_SETTINGS_V4
serial_settings['url'] = port
protocol = partial(DSMRProtocol, loop, telegram_parser(specifications),
telegram_callback=telegram_callback)
conn = create_serial_connection(loop, protocol, **serial_settings)
return conn
class DSMRProtocol(asyncio.Protocol):
"""Assemble and handle incoming data into complete DSM telegrams."""
transport = None
telegram_callback = None
def __init__(self, loop, telegram_parser, telegram_callback=None):
"""Initialize class."""
self.loop = loop
self.log = logging.getLogger(__name__)
self.telegram_parser = telegram_parser
# callback to call on complete telegram
self.telegram_callback = telegram_callback
# buffer to keep incoming telegram lines
self.telegram = []
# buffer to keep incomplete incoming data
self.buffer = ''
def connection_made(self, transport):
"""Just logging for now."""
self.transport = transport
self.log.debug('connected')
def data_received(self, data):
"""Add incoming data to buffer."""
data = data.decode()
self.log.debug('received data: %s', data.strip())
self.buffer += data
self.handle_lines()
def handle_lines(self):
"""Assemble incoming data into single lines."""
while "\r\n" in self.buffer:
line, self.buffer = self.buffer.split("\r\n", 1)
self.log.debug('got line: %s', line)
# Telegrams need to be complete because the values belong to a
# particular reading and can also be related to eachother.
if not self.telegram and not is_start_of_telegram(line):
continue
self.telegram.append(line)
if is_end_of_telegram(line):
try:
parsed_telegram = self.telegram_parser.parse(self.telegram)
self.handle_telegram(parsed_telegram)
except ParseError:
self.log.exception("failed to parse telegram")
self.telegram = []
def connection_lost(self, exc):
"""Stop when connection is lost."""
self.log.error('disconnected')
def handle_telegram(self, telegram):
"""Send off parsed telegram to handling callback."""
self.log.debug('got telegram: %s', telegram)
if self.telegram_callback:
self.telegram_callback(telegram)
